2017-1-6基础
html属性
1基本属性 class 定义类规则或样式规则 id 定义元素的唯一标识 style 定义元素的样式声明2语言属性
lang 定义元素的语言代码或编码 dir 定义文本方向 包括ltr(从左向右)、rtl(从右向左)3键盘属性 accesskey 定义访问某元素的键盘快捷方式 tabindex 定义元素的tab键索引编号 使用accesskey属性可以用快捷键alt+字母访问指定的URL,但是浏览器不能很好的支持。内容属性 alt 定义元素的替换文本 title 定义元素的提示信息 longdesc 定义元素包含内容的大段描述信息 cite 定义元素包含内容的引用信息 datetime 定义元素包含内容的日期和时间html元素 HTML5元素分为7大类 内嵌 在文档添加其他类型的内容 如audio 、video 、canvas 、iframe等 流 在文档和应用的body中使用的元素,如form 、h1和small等 标题 段落标题,如h1、h2好和hgroup等 交互 与用户交互的内容,如音频和视频的控件、button和textarea等 元数据 通常在也想的head中 短语 文本和文本标记元素,如mark、kbd、sub和sup等HTML5新增的语义化标记元素 header 标记头部区域的内容 footer 标记脚部区域的内容 section web页面中的一块区域 article 独立的文章内容 aside 相关内容或引文 nav 导航类辅助内容HTML5新增功能元素 hgroup元素 用于对整个页面或页面中的一个内容区块标题进行组合 figure元素 表示一段独立的流内容,一般表示文档主体流内容中的一个独立单元。使用figcaption元素可为figure元素添加标题。 列:audio 元素,定义音频
cmbed 元素 用来插入各种多媒体 mark 元素 主要用来在视觉上向用户呈现那些需要突出显示或高亮的文字。 time 元素 表示时间或日期,也可以同时表示两者 canvas 元素 表示图形,如图表和其他图像,提供一块画布,把一个绘图API展现给客户端JS,使脚本可以在上面绘制 output 元素 表示不同类型的输出,比如脚本的输出 source 元素 为媒介元素定义媒介资源 menu 元素 表示菜单列表。 ruby 表示ruby注释 rt 元素 表示字符的解释或发音 rp 元素 在ruby注释中使用,以定义不支持ruby元素浏览器所显示的内容 wbr 软换行 command 元素 表示命令按钮,如单选按钮、复选框或按钮 details 元素 表示用户要求得到并且可以得到的细节信息,可以与summary元素配合使用。summary元素提供标题或图例。标题是可见的,用户单机标题是,会显示细节信息 。summary是details的第一个子元素列标题
详细信息
datalist 元素 表示可选数据的列表,与input元素配合使用,可以制作出输入值下拉列表
datagrid 元素 表示可选数据的列表,它以树形列表的形式来显示 keygen 元素 表示生成密钥 progress 表示运行中的进程可以用progress元素来显示JS中耗费时间的函数进程 email 表示必须输入email地址的文本输入框 url 表示必须输入URL的文本输入框 number 表示必须输入数值的文本输入框 range 表示必须输入一定范围内数字的文本输入框 Data Pickers HTML5拥有多个可供选取日期和时间的新型输入文本框 date 选取日 月 年 month 选取 月和年 week 选取周和年 time 选取时间(小时和分钟) datetime 选取时间 日 月 年 datetime-local 选取时间 日 月 年(本地时间)